6. It's a nebula, way out there.
http://antwrp.gsfc.nasa.gov/apod/ap061018.html

Explanation: What created this huge space bubble? Blown by the wind from a star,
this tantalizing, ghostly apparition is cataloged as NGC 7635, but known simply as
The Bubble Nebula. Astronomer Eric Mouquet's striking view utilizes a long exposure
with hydrogen alpha light to reveal the intricate details of this cosmic bubble and its environment.
Although it looks delicate, the 10 light-year diameter bubble offers evidence of
violent processes at work. Seen here above and right of the Bubble's center is a bright hot star
embedded in reflecting dust. A fierce stellar wind and intense radiation from the star,
which likely has a mass 10 to 20 times that of the Sun, has blasted out the structure of glowing gas
against denser material in a surrounding molecular cloud. The intriguing Bubble Nebula lies a mere
11,000 light-years away toward the boastful constellation Cassiopeia.

62. No, NOT Office, I'm talking about Windows XP itself...
Edited on Sun Oct-22-06 11:48 AM by Solon
there is no "trial version" of Windows XP, if you are running Windows XP, you should have the install disk. Its NOT a part of the Microsoft Office Package, its part of the Windows XP package. I don't have Microsoft office, and I have paint, as an example.

ON EDIT: OK, I'm going to try to be a little clearer, I can see where you could be confused, go in the CONTROL PANEL, and select the "Add or Remove Programs" Icon. Now, a window will pop up that is populated by ALL installed programs, ignore that. On the Left side is a series of icons, the 3rd one down says "Add or Remove Windows Components", click on it.

Windows Components Wizard will now come up. OK, "Accessories and Utilities" should already be highlighted, click on the "details" button while that is selected. A new window pops up, with two selections "Accessories" and "Games", make sure "Accessories" is selected, then hit the Details button again. Now, a new window pops up with a listing of programs on it, look at the bottom program listing, it should simply say "Paint", and checkmark the box next to it. Now, you most likely will need the Windows XP install CD to install paint, wait for the program to ask for it before you put it in.

64. Pretty easy once you get the hang of it...
Edited on Sun Oct-22-06 11:58 AM by Solon
On Windows, hit the PrtScrn button, then enter you favorite painting program(paint is a good program) and select "Paste from Clipboard". Then save the resulting image in the program. Once done, go to an image hosting site, like Imageshack, and upload the picture through that, the website will give you a URL of where the image is located online. Use the plain URL here on DU and the Image will come up.
